Core Elements of Multiplier Pathways
Multipliers in these titles function through incremental stages rather than flat additions, with each stage unlocked by meeting specific conditions such as landing three matching symbols or completing a mini-round. Research from the University of Nevada's gaming laboratory shows that pathways incorporating both additive and multiplicative steps produce payout distributions that differ from traditional fixed-bonus structures, leading to wider variance within single sessions. Observers note that emerging developers frequently combine these ladders with cascading reels, allowing one successful chain to feed directly into the next level without resetting the counter.
Touch-responsive interfaces play a central role because mobile hardware supports rapid input that aligns with fast multiplier escalation. When a pathway reaches its upper tiers, visual indicators such as glowing borders or expanding meters signal the current stage, and studies of player behavior reveal that clear feedback loops increase session duration across several tested titles. Mobile Design Constraints and Solutions
Screen real estate limits force developers to compress pathway information into expandable panels that users activate with a single tap, while background animations continue to display ongoing multiplier growth. Data compiled by the American Gaming Association indicates that titles optimized for 60 frames per second on 5G networks retain higher completion rates for complex multiplier sequences compared with those running at lower refresh rates. Emerging studios address battery and heat concerns by limiting particle effects during high-multiplier phases, shifting emphasis to numeric readouts instead.

Sound design contributes another layer, with ascending tone sequences that match each step on the multiplier path. Those who have examined telemetry from multiple platforms report that audio cues synchronized to multiplier thresholds correlate with increased repeat engagement, particularly in markets outside major regulatory zones. Developers therefore test these elements across diverse handset models to maintain consistency.
Examples from Independent Releases
One studio based in Eastern Europe released a title in early 2026 that routes multipliers through a grid of collectible icons, where each new icon collected raises the active multiplier by an additional increment until a cap is reached. Figures released by the Australian Communications and Media Authority show similar collection mechanics appearing in several other niche offerings, with average session multipliers climbing between 4x and 12x depending on the length of uninterrupted play. Another developer incorporated a dual-path system allowing users to choose between a safer steady climb or a riskier accelerated route that can reset on missed triggers.
These variations illustrate how emerging teams experiment with branching structures rather than linear ladders, and academic papers in the International Gambling Studies journal document that branching pathways alter risk perception among frequent mobile users. The pattern holds across multiple titles regardless of theme, suggesting the mechanic itself drives engagement more than narrative framing.
Regulatory and Market Context in 2026
Market analysts tracking August 2026 note that licensing bodies in several jurisdictions have begun requesting detailed documentation on multiplier algorithms before approving new mobile releases. This scrutiny stems from concerns over transparency in how pathways calculate final payouts, prompting studios to publish simplified flowcharts alongside game rules. Industry groups such as the European Gaming and Betting Association have circulated guidelines encouraging clear disclosure of maximum multiplier caps, which many new developers now include in their submission packages.
Cross-border data sharing has also increased, allowing regulators to compare multiplier distributions across regions and identify titles that deviate from established norms. Those monitoring these trends report that emerging studios adapt by building adjustable settings that let operators tailor pathway lengths to local requirements without rebuilding core code.
